T
Toast
Address
133 Upper Street, London
Postcode District
N1
City
London
County
London
Country
England
Show map
Calculate route
Download AutoMapa navigation
Nearest POIs
133 Upper Street, London
Kings Head Theatre
115 Upper Street, London N1 1QN
B Holder
62 Cross Street, London
Rajmoni Indian Cuisine
279 Upper Street, London
Blueheath Cash & Carry Wholesalers
132 Upper Street, London N1 2UQ
After Noah
121 Upper Street, London
Papa John's
123 Upper Street, London
Thyme & Lemon
139 Upper Street, London N1 2UQ
Carluccios
Upper Street, London N1 2XF
Neal's Yard Remedies
295 Upper Street, London N1 2TU
Ryman the Stationer
114 Upper Street, London N1 1QN
Nearest POIs from category Clothes - Shop
133 Upper Street, London
In Theory
56 Cross Street, London N1 2BA
Diverse
294 Upper Street, London N1 2TU
White Stuff
Essex Road, London
Hobbs
Upper Street, London
NOA NOA
152 Upper Street, London
Militaria
8 Charlton Place, London
Diverse
286 Upper Street, London N1 2TZ
Fat Faced Cat
24 Camden Passage, London
Tallulah Lingerie
65 Cross Street, London N1 2BB
Paper Mache Tiger
26 Cross Street, London N1 2BG